Job Summary

  • The position supports clinical and translational research within the Division of Surgical Oncology with a focus on gastrointestinal malignancies.
  • Technicians are responsible for collecting, processing, and preserving human biospecimens while maintaining strict regulatory compliance and data integrity.
  • Employees will utilize advanced technologies like the Elephas Live Platform to assess immune-based therapeutic responses on fresh tumor specimens.
